Hollow Knight Silksong price point is causing developers to rethink pricing


artwork for Hollow Knight: Silksong

The excellent Hollow Knight: Silksong launched yesterday for the grand price of $20 / £16.75 but some developers who’ve spoken to Eurogamer believe that price point is too low and could reflect badly on their games which are set to be slightly more. It should be noted that Team Cherry has four core team members, and it uses some contracted help, whereas AAA games can have over a thousand working on a project. It will be interesting to see if Silksong’s price point could affect video game pricing going forward.
